Leeds Rhinos 6 Catalans Dragons 34 - how the players rated

The scoreline didn't tell the full story of Leeds Rhinos' 34-6 defeat by Catalans Dragons.

Rhinos, including seven debutants, gave a good account of themselves against a near full-strength Catalans outfit who scored 12 of their points in the final four minutes.

Some of the Leeds youngsters look to have a bright future. Here's how we rated individuals of both sides.
